As each plant grows, you'll see small tobacco plants (suckers or basal shoots) starting to grow as side-shoots from the main stalk at the base of the leaves, the same as with tomatoes and that other stuff some people smoke. Nicotiana (/ ˌ n ɪ k oʊ ʃ i ˈ eɪ n ə, n ɪ ˌ k oʊ-,-k ɒ t i-,-ˈ ɑː n ə,-ˈ æ n ə /) is a genus of herbaceous plants and shrubs in the family Solanaceae, that is indigenous to the Americas, Australia, south west Africa and the South Pacific.
